    Manager of Safety - Los Angeles, United States - Alstom

    Default job background
    Description

    Req ID:445323

    Leading societies to a low carbon future, Alstom develops and markets mobility solutions that provide the sustainable foundations for the future of transportation. Our product portfolio ranges from high-speed trains, metros, monorail, and trams to integrated systems, customised services, infrastructure, signalling and digital mobility solutions. Joining us means joining a caring, responsible, and innovative company where more than 70,000 people lead the way to greener and smarter mobility, worldwide

    Develop safety programs in alignment with the SCRRA Safety Plan, ensure compliance with all rules and regulations, and provide guidance to field personnel. In coordination with the Training Manager, the Safety Manager will help create safety related training for employees. Perform day to day safety monitoring of safety related activities involving operational and maintenance employees. Oversee all items relating to regulations, rules, inspections, audits, testing, incident investigation, and corrective action plans. The Manager of Safety shall utilize data to perform trending and tracking of hazards and provide a risk-based analysis of all incidents. The Manager of Safety shall report to the AGMTRCS and shall not be responsible for operational and maintenance KPI's.

    Duties/Responsibilities:

    • Develop submittal and support the Training Plan under 49CFR‐Part 243 regulations.
    • Maintain documentation of training and qualifications performed of contractors, subcontractors, third parties, Authority, and public agency employees.
    • Manage the Title 49, CFR, Part 219 program.
    • Ensure contract compliance with Federal, State, and local regulations and with SCRRA Standards, Rules, Regulations and Policies.
    • Perform field observations, and audits.
    • Develop training curriculum, programs, testing and qualification guidelines.
    • Develop a safety culture to ensure all staff are adequately trained and understand the Rules, Regulations and Safety Standards.
    • Perform regular consultation and plan meetings with the Authority's Safety and training Manager.
    • Immediate condition response and initiate for care of employee(s), document, and investigation of incident and or accident.
    • Participate and attend authority Safety committee meetings, Root Cause Analysis and close out.
    • Follow up reporting, fact findings and corrective actions.
    • Maintain a strong relationship with Authority safety and risk management personnel.
    • Ensures compliance with Federal State and local regulations.
    • Other duties as assigned.
